The Increasing Popularity for Women Photographers for Weddings

In recent years, many newlyweds have started searching for female wedding photographers. This change is in part due to cultural preferences, especially in South Asian and Muslim communities, where modesty is key. Female photographers can make brides and their relatives feel more comfortable during personal times, such as bridal preparations. Additionally, many female photographers add a distinct creative viewpoint to the table, providing a gentler and more empathetic touch to their work.

Photography for Indian Weddings: A Magnificent Celebration

Indian weddings are known for their extravagance. Photography for Indian weddings centers around documenting the fine details of rituals like the Haldi, Mehndi, and Sangeet, as well as the primary wedding day. From vibrant attire and bright decorations to heartfelt family moments, a skilled Indian wedding photographer understands how to capture the essence of each ritual. Professional photographers who focus on Indian weddings have an attention to detail and are skilled in working in fast-paced environments.

Pakistani Wedding Photography: A Mix of Custom and Elegance

Pakistani weddings are graceful yet deeply traditional. Pakistani wedding photography must capture the many traditions, such as the Nikah (marriage contract) and the Walima (post-wedding reception). Photographers often must alternate formal and candid shots to capture the range of feelings during these extended celebrations. With Pakistani weddings typically including large guest lists and complex setups, the photographer's skill to navigate these events smoothly is essential.

Photography for Bangladeshi Weddings: Colorful and Rich in Tradition

Photography for Bangladeshi weddings is all about capturing the brightness of events like the Gaye Holud and the reception. Weddings in Bengal are vivid, featuring music and traditions that differ among Hindu and Muslim communities. An experienced photographer knows these differences and adapts their approach to fit the traditions of the families involved.

Specialized Photographers for Religious Weddings

Whether it’s a photographer for Muslim weddings, a Sikh wedding photographer, or a Hindu wedding photographer, each specialist offers cultural awareness to the table. For instance, a Muslim wedding photographer would pay attention to important moments like the Nikah and capture the elegance and beauty of the bride and groom. Sikh wedding photographers, on the other hand, pay attention to the Anand Karaj (Sikh wedding ceremony), with attention to traditional attire and the religious customs in the Gurdwara.
